Label Text
Originally subordinate to a larger central pendant, this beautiful filigree piece is one of the oldest in the collection and demonstrates the earlier mixture of gold and silver known as urus sasel.
Description
Gold-plated silver alloy pendant of almond shaped undulating openwork filigree base, surmounted by a projecting flower and tiered rosette with globule. There are smaller rosettes at each point of the almond, and groups of three filigree leaves on the sides of the almond. Openwork triangular elements circumnavigate the pendant. Flower and rosettes are mounted on a hammered flat bar and disc of metal. Some of the gum arabic used to affix the top rosette to the bottom of the pendant is visible at the back of the pendant.
